Temiar Orang Asli tribe seeks upgrade to bamboo houses in Pos Simpor

-

GUA MUSANG: The Temiar Orang Asli tribe in Pos Simpor has asked the government to consider building additional brick houses to replace their existing bamboo houses.

Pos Simpor Orang Asli village developmen­t and safety committee chairman Dendi Johari said so far, only some residents enjoyed such housing facilities built in 11 villages there through the Home Assistance Programme (PBR).

Dendi said more housing assistance is required to accommodat­e the growing population each year which will, at the same time, become better homes to be inherited by future generation­s.

“Most of the houses were built by the residents using wood and bamboo but they are easily damaged and need a lot of maintenanc­e. As such, I hope there will be more housing programmes to help the Orang Asli in the interior this year.

“So far, about 86 new houses are needed to replace the houses of residents in Kampung Sedal, Kampung Penad, Kampung Ceranok, Kampung Dandut, Kampung Jader Lama, Kampung Jader Baru, Kampung Rekom, Kampung Simpor and Kampung Kledang,” Dendi told reporters here yesterday.

Kampung Jader Lama resident Lama Ami Along, 59, echoed the same sentiments, saying many people in his village are still waiting for the PBR to enable them to have more comfortabl­e houses that are equipped with rooms and toilets.

“Although living in a bamboo house is a heritage from our ancestors and a tradition of ours, I feel that our children and grandchild­ren need to live in better and more comfortabl­e homes.

“I ask that the government consider our needs although we are in the interior,” he said.

Meanwhile, Galas assemblyma­n Mohd Syahbuddin Hashim said it was appropriat­e to upgrade the premises of the Orang Asli, thereby increasing the number of houses under the PBR. He said the Gua Musang Orang Asli village head had brought up the issue of infrastruc­ture requiremen­ts when Deputy Prime Minister Datuk Seri Dr Ahmad Zahid Hamidi visited Gua Musang last October.
